Performance Tuning BI on SAP NetWeaver Using DB2 for i5/OS and i5 Navigator
Optimal performance of BI queries relies on many factors. Size of the underlying tables, complexity of the query, existence of indexes, sophistication of the query optimizer, hardware configurations and other factors all play a role in the performance of any given query on the system.
